NEWS: "No Family Left Behind" Gala a hit

The Northern Illinois PFLAG umbrella organization's gala fundraiser, "No Family Left Behind" held at Kendall College on April 30 was a hit. Oak Park PFLAG joined in the efforts. The fundraiser honored Illinois lawmakers who were instrumental in passing the recent anti-discrimination legislation which makes Illinois the 15th state in the country to boast such a law.

Rick Garcia, political director of Equality Illinois, the group that spearheaded lobbying for the bill, told those attending the gala that key in getting the bill passed was support from PFLAG - members, including those from Oak Park PFLAG, met with lawmakers in Springfield to express their support for the bill.
